Skip to content

Latest commit

 

History

History
104 lines (58 loc) · 3.33 KB

jt-proposal.md

File metadata and controls

104 lines (58 loc) · 3.33 KB

Juniors Spring Intensive Deliverable Proposal

TODO: copy this file, fill it out, and push it up to your project's repo.

Dates 3/16-3/25

My Name: Jessica Trinh

Project Name: Divvy

Is your project New or Old? Old

Is your project Solo or Team? Team

Description

Write a paragraph summary of the current status of your project, what you hope to achieve during the intensive, how and why

Currently Divvy's prototype and MVP is functional, I would like to continue to reiterate on it so that it may have the quality and polish needed to ship to the app store.

Challenges I Anticipate

List out the challenges you anticipate for completing this project

  • implementing web scraper into iOS framework
  • knowing when it's truly app store ready
  • time limit/scoping
  • working 100% remotely from my teammate

Skateboard

ONE SINGLE aspect of product. Consider: build backend for SPD 1.2 front end, CRUD one resource, use API or library, authentication etc.

Start coding and finish “Skateboard” feature before beginning “Bike”.

Implement Firebase authentication and authorization for Login/Signup Page. Improve UX with prompts regarding password/email and "Continue as Guest" button to provide actionable instructions

Login: https://github.com/ellojess/Divvy/tree/master/Divvy/Login

Signup: https://github.com/ellojess/Divvy/tree/master/Divvy/SignUp

Bike

ONE additional features that get you closer to your idealized product. Examples: CRUD 2nd resource, add comments, API use, authentication, library use

Implement Firebase and Firestore for Chatoom feature

Chatroom code can be viewed here: https://github.com/ellojess/Divvy/tree/master/Divvy/Chat

Car

ONE additional feature

Work out kinks in web scraper and implement the web scraper API into the iOS framework. Currently web scraper can only scrape categories but it needs to be able to scrape price, image, and other details as well.

Web Scraper can be found here: https://github.com/ellojess/MakeScraper

Personal Achievement Goals:

Each teammate must achieve 2 of 3 of their self-set personal achievement goals. If you're not on a team, delete the other teammate sections as needed.

Teammate 1: Henry Calderon

  1. refactor marketplace to be of app store quality
  2. create cart feature for items to be added to
  3. proper display/dismissing of views

Wireframes

Insert wireframe pictures here

Divvy: https://drive.google.com/drive/folders/1unBJLP-4GyDM9vyCHhDi7Jk-y73QeKXG?usp=sharing

Evaluation

You must meet the following criteria in order to pass the intensive:

  • Students must get proposal approved before starting the project to pass
  • SOLO
    • must score an average above a 2.5 on the rubric
  • TEAM
    • Must score an average above 3 on the rubric
    • Each individual completes 2 of the 3 personal achievement goals from their proposal
  • Pitch your product

Approval Checklist

  • If I have a team project, I wrote this proposal to represent my work and only my work
  • I have completed all the necessary parts of this proposal
  • I linked my proposal in the Spring Intensive Tracker

Sign off

Student Name:

Jessica Trinh / Mar 16, 2020

Make School Advisor Name

Jessamyn